In Sol's NaJo, she bewailed the fact that new schools=new germs, and asked who could've predicted the rounds and rounds of colds her family's been suffering this school year. Well, anyone that works in a schoolsmiley - winkeye

Every school year, new students come in, bringing new germs with them. This year hasn't been so bad--then again, our room started the year with only 2 new students. You see, I work in a special education class, so we hold on to the same students for a few years.

Or the fewer health problems so far could be related to the fact that our class changed rooms this year (for the first time in 20 years). We have storage! And running water! And we don't have to get wet every time we leave the room on a rainy day! Which, besides the obvious, means we don't have to try to shove a ream's-worth of copies under our coats to keep them dry! The biggest difference, health-wise, was something I didn't even realize until they started fixing up the old portable. Once the skirting was removed, you could smell mold from 100 feet away, for half a week. Not just a little, reminds-one-pleasantly-of-compost smell (which shouldn't be coming out from under a mostly-wood raised building, if you think about it...), but a thick, choking, cover-your-nose-and/or-hold-your-breath-as-you-pass smell. No wonder I've been constantly run down the last few years! I thought 'twas stress and the revolving door of students (and last year, teachers) we'd been having, which I'm sure wasn't helpful. And no wonder we had some students with constantly running noses. This year is much better, so far.
